The food was great. Our table of 6 tried a variety of menu options. Inexpensive cocktails during happy hour. The waitstaff was fun and knowledgeable. We even ended up meeting the chef and chatting with him. SG is a down to earth, non stuffy restaurant. The only drawback is that parking is a bit of a hassle. Otherwise I recommend.

Every time we visit we have the best time and can't stop talking about how great the food is....every single thing! The shrimp and grits are always my go to and my husband loves the meatloaf. We also got the scallop appetizer and some cornbread to share and already want to add both to our normal order when we return. The staff is incredibly kind and knowledgeable and the space is always cozy and has that Richmond charm.

We've been here many times and the most recent was probably our least favorite. We still love this place and will for sure be back, this just wasn't our best visit. We went early (5ish) and maybe they just weren't ready for dinner service. Our pimento cheese was very cold and hard to spread.. They must have been out of the usual bread because it was served with bread that looked like cut up and toasted hot dog buns. It was impossible to spread the hard cheese on them. When we received our entrees, my macaroni and cheese was cold and yet my husband's mashed potatoes were so hot he couldn't eat them for a while. The steak and meatloaf were pretty good. The peanut butter pie was delicious and big enough for two to share. Next time I am eating just that! The server was great. The food was just a little less outstanding than you would expect when paying $100 for dinner for two.

The Savory Grain is a charming, boutique-sized restaurant with a warm and welcoming atmosphere. We went for brunch on the first Sunday of the year, and it was truly special. Live musicians filled the space with beautiful songs, making the experience feel even more memorable. The service was excellent--so attentive and kind to my family. Every dish we ordered was absolutely delicious, and the hibiscus mimosa was epic. Overall, a wonderful brunch experience that we can't wait to enjoy again.
